Motel Hell (1980)

It takes all kinds of critters to make Farmer Vincent fritters!

Motel Hell (1980) poster

Farmer Vincent Smith and his sister Ida run a motel attached to a farm where they capture unsuspecting travelers, bury them alive, fatten them up and then harvest their bodies as ingredients for his famous brand of "smoked meats."
